Hi Sandy you can do this. I did. Stage 2b adenocarcinoma. Originally had chemo rads and was left with a small residual tumour central cervical canal. That was October last year. After scans and further biopsy I had a robotic hysterectomy on 22 nd March and was given the all clear 2 weeks ago. It was a nerve wrecking meeting to be told the results. All I can advise is take one step at a time and you will get there. Chemo rads is the most affective treatment and it is a small minority that is left with residual so please don’t worry x

Hi all, just a little update. Yesterday had my first oncology meeting and was given the plan of 5 weeks rads mon-fri and chemo every Monday. Will also be doing 2 brachy and have to go to London as here in Malta still don’t do them. It was kind of another shock that I have to leave for two weeks for the last treatment but now I keep saying that I will do it no matter what.
